South Bend is home to some of the most unique small businesses that offer one-of-a-kind experiences for residents and visitors to enjoy. From local restaurants to small boutiques, South Bend has adventures waiting for everyone.
The General Deli & Café is home to what appears to be an endless list of food, coffees, sweets and sides. They are located on E. Jefferson Blvd. and provide a variety perfect for any family, couple, group or individual looking for a spot to visit.
Plenty of seating is available for those who wish to stay, though anything can be made to-go. Open early at 7 a.m., they are ideal for any college student needing a place for early studying or a quick grab-and-go coffee.
The General Deli & Café is not only for those who enjoy the coffee shop atmosphere. They provide plenty of other food options for those looking for more of a dining experience . Sandwiches including pastrami, Rueben and grilled ham & cheese are on the menu as well as many others. Potato salad, pasta salad, soups, salads and breakfast items are also available. Simple grab-and-go items such as fruits, muffins, scones and bagels are also readily available at any time.
While visiting The General Deli & Café, I tried a classic iced vanilla latte and was pleasantly surprised at the smooth taste. A popular choice is the soup cup and half-sandwich deal; the price is great, and you are able to try two of their delicious offers rather than only one.
With free Wi-Fi, The General Deli & Café is a perfect spot for any morning or daytime stops for a peaceful study break or a time to relax.
